Family, friends and strangers from all over the world have taken to Facebook to offer their thoughts and prayers for slain San Bernardino terror victim Nicholas Thalasinos.

Thalasinos, a self described Messianic gentile and ardent supporter of Israel, was one of 14 people killed last week by husband and wife terror duo and ISIS supporters Syed Farook and Tashfeen Malik.

Two weeks before the terror attack, Thalasinos and Farook reportedly got into a heated argument about the nature of Islam. During the exchange, Farook told Thalasinos, “You will never see Israel.”

Over the weekend, Farook’s father, also called Sayed Farook, told an Italian newspaper that his son was “obsessed with Israel” and wished for the country’s destruction.

Following the attack and the revelations of Thalasinos’ pro-Israel, anti-Islam stance, many have speculated that he was singled out by Farook for his religious and political views. Jennifer Thalasinos, widow of Nicholas, even told the media that she believes “her husband was martyred for his faith and beliefs.”
